Over the course of his career, Mr. Porlier has acquired extensive experience working in different Cain Lamarre offices, notably in Val-d’Or, Saguenay and Sept-Îles. He has represented his clients in all the Quebec courts, in the fields of Aboriginal law, constitutional law and business law. He has also given talks at conferences and taught several courses on the establishment of partnerships with Indigenous entities, economic development and sustainable development. His academic and professional contributions are a testament to his professional expertise and devotion to his clients, which have made him a leader in his field. Mr. Porlier has a Law degree from Université Laval and is also actively involved in his community. He is a master’s-level instructor and one of the few trainers recognized by the Canadian Council for Aboriginal Business. For his outstanding contributions, he received a Global Excellence Award for Outstanding Aboriginal Lawyer in Quebec in 2020 and a Legal Award in Commercial Law in Canada in 2019.
